The Benefits of Whey Protein for Athletic Performance
Whey protein is a popular supplement among athletes and fitness enthusiasts for its numerous benefits, particularly for athletic performance.
Builds and Repairs Muscle
Whey protein is a rich source of amino acids, particularly leucine, which is essential for muscle protein synthesis. Consuming whey protein before or after workouts can help stimulate muscle growth and repair, resulting in stronger and more developed muscles over time.
Increases Strength and Power
Regular consumption of whey protein has been shown to improve strength and power performance in athletes, particularly in resistance training. This is because it can increase muscle mass and improve muscle recovery, allowing athletes to perform better and for longer periods.
Boosts Endurance and Stamina
Whey protein can also improve endurance and stamina by increasing the delivery of oxygen and nutrients to muscles during long and intense workouts. This can help delay fatigue and improve overall performance.
Reduces Muscle Soreness and Inflammation
Intense workouts can lead to muscle soreness and inflammation, which can negatively affect performance. Whey protein has anti-inflammatory properties that can help reduce muscle soreness and promote faster recovery.

Comparing the Different Types of Whey Protein: Which is Right for You?
Choosing the right type of whey protein can be confusing with so many options available in the market. At a high level, there are three types of whey protein available:
- Whey Protein Concentrate (WPC)
- Whey Protein Isolate (WPI)
- Whey Protein Hydrolysate (WPH)
Here's a closer look at each type:
Whey Protein Concentrate (WPC)
Whey protein concentrate is the most commonly available type of whey protein. It's made by separating whey protein from milk and then concentrating it by removing some of the fat and lactose. As a result, WPC contains anywhere from 30% to 80% protein by weight, with the remaining percentage made up of fat, lactose and minerals.
WPC is cheaper than the other types of whey protein and contains small amounts of other beneficial nutrients besides protein, such as trace minerals, immune-enhancing nutrients and bioactive compounds. If you're looking for a budget-friendly option and don't have any lactose intolerance or dairy allergies, WPC could be a good choice for you.
Whey Protein Isolate (WPI)
Whey protein isolate is a more refined form of whey protein concentrate. It's made by further removing the fat and lactose from WPC, resulting in a protein content of 90% or higher. WPI is a better option for those who are lactose intolerant or have dairy allergies, as it contains very little lactose.
WPI is a bit more expensive than WPC, but it has a higher protein content and is lower in fat and lactose. It's a good option for those looking to add more protein to their diet without the extra calories and carbs.
Whey Protein Hydrolysate (WPH)
Whey protein hydrolysate is another form of whey protein that undergoes a process of partial hydrolysis, where the protein chains are partially broken down into smaller pieces called peptides. This makes it easier for your body to absorb and use the protein, making it a popular choice for athletes and bodybuilders.
WPH is the most expensive form of whey protein and often tastes bitter due to the hydrolysis process. It's a good option for those looking for a fast-absorbing protein source to help with muscle recovery after exercise.
Which Whey Protein is Right for You?
Ultimately, the decision on which whey protein to choose depends on your individual needs and budget. If you're looking for a budget-friendly option and don't have any lactose intolerance or dairy allergies, go for whey protein concentrate. If you have lactose intolerance or dairy allergies, or want a higher protein content, go for whey protein isolate. If you're an athlete looking for a fast-absorbing protein source for muscle recovery, go for whey protein hydrolysate.
Remember, no matter which type of whey protein you choose, it's important to still consume a balanced diet and not solely rely on protein powder for your nutritional needs.
How to Incorporate Whey Protein into Your Diet for Optimal Results
If you've decided to start taking whey protein to help you reach your fitness goals, it's important to know how to properly incorporate it into your diet for optimal results. Here are some tips to help you get the most out of your whey protein powder:
1. Start with a small amount: When you first start taking whey protein, start with a small amount to help your body adjust. Gradually increase the amount as your body becomes accustomed to the extra protein intake.
2. Choose the right time to consume whey protein: The best time to consume whey protein is right after a workout. This is when your muscles are most in need of nutrients to help them recover and grow. However, you can also consume whey protein at other times of the day as part of a balanced diet.
3. Mix it up: Don't be afraid to try different ways to consume whey protein. You can mix it with water, milk, or fruit juice. You can also add it to smoothies, oatmeal, or even baked goods.
4. Keep it simple: While there are many flavor options available, it's best to stick with a plain or lightly flavored whey protein powder. This will allow you to easily add it to different foods without altering the taste too much.
5. Be consistent: In order to see results, it's important to be consistent with your whey protein intake. Make sure you're consuming it regularly, whether it's daily or after each workout.
Incorporating whey protein into your diet can help you reach your fitness goals faster. By following these tips, you can ensure that you're getting the most out of your protein powder.
